PostgreSQL в Cluster'е

Регистрация
27 Фев 2015
Сообщения
30
Реакции
17
Может не на профильном форуме, но все же...

Есть ли хорошее "решение" для построения HA кластера (Multi-Master) на СУБД PostgreSQL 9.5 считай из коробки?
Решений в виде танцов с бубном и нано-напильником не предлагать...

PS: Этакий mariadb galera cluster, но для PG :cool:
PPS: Пока склоняюсь в сторону Postgres-XL...
 
Можешь глянуть на Pgpool-II
 
corosync pacemaker все любят прям тащутся, но конечно это уже прошлый век, galera maxscale - сам только начал заниматься, но там одна бд для записи и две для чтения, не знаешь про логирование в Maxscale?
 
Почитай про BDR. Как я понял, в 9.6 это уже из коробки.
 
Не понятно чем вам не угодил pacemaker. Не устаревающая классика, словно Чак Норрис.
 
Еще добавлю, что обсуждаемые WAL, BDR и прочие репликации - не кластерное решение. Т.е. база то будет синхронизироваться, но при любом факапе реплика не станет основной базой для софта, использующего постресс.

Тем не менее, BDR не является инструментом для кластеризации, т.к. здесь нет каких-либо глобальных менеджеров блокировок или координаторов транзакций (привет Для просмотра ссылки Войди или Зарегистрируйся/XL). Каждый узел не зависит от других, что было бы невозможно в случае использования менеджеров блокировки. Каждый из узлов содержит локальную копию данных идентичную данным на других узлах.
 
Назад
Сверху